Spicy Beer-Battered Fish

A crunchy and tantalizing main dish with a hint of spice. Perfect for an easy midweek meal.

Main Dish
Medium 15 min 450 cal
Steps

1. In a bowl, mix together the flour, garlic powder, cayenne pepper and a pinch of salt. 2. Pour the beer into the bowl and stir until you form a thick batter. 3. Cut the fish fillet into bite-sized cubes. 4. Dip the fish cubes into the batter and coat thoroughly. 5. Heat some oil in a frying pan over medium heat. 6. Once the oil is hot, carefully add the battered fish cubes to the pan and fry until golden and crisp (about 4-5 minutes). 7. Serve and enjoy!

Ingredients

Ingredients for 1 person -100g white fish fillet -2 tbsp beer -4 tbsp all-purpose flour -1/2 tsp garlic powder -1/2 tsp cayenne pepper -Salt -Oil, for frying
